ZIP 76005 and ZIP 76006 are ZIP Code areas in Texas.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 76006 has the higher population (23,594 vs 6,165 in ZIP 76005). ZIP 76005 has the higher median household income ($174,352 vs $55,216 in ZIP 76006). ZIP 76005 has the higher median home value ($482,100 vs $286,900 in ZIP 76006).
